Files
myprojplanet_vite/src/views/requestresetpwd/requestresetpwd.vue

66 lines
1.5 KiB
Vue
Raw Normal View History

2021-09-16 21:08:02 +02:00
<template>
<div class="row justify-center text-center padding">
<div class="q-gutter-sm q-ma-sm" style="max-width: 800px; margin: auto;">
<div v-if="!emailinviata">
<q-banner
rounded
class="bg-primary text-white"
style="text-align: center;">
<span class="mybanner">{{ $t('reset.title_reset_pwd') }}</span>
</q-banner>
<br>
<q-input
v-model="form.email"
rounded outlined
autocomplete="email"
:error="v$.form.email.$error"
:error-message="errorMsg('email', v$.form.email)"
maxlength="50"
debounce="1000"
:label="$t('reg.email')">
<template v-slot:prepend>
<q-icon name="email"/>
</template>
</q-input>
<br>
<div class="center q-ma-sm">
<q-btn
rounded size="lg" color="primary" @click="submit" :disable="v$.$error">
{{ $t('reset.send_reset_pwd') }}
</q-btn>
</div>
</div>
<div v-else>
<q-banner
rounded
class="bg-positive text-white"
style="text-align: center;">
<span class="mybanner">{{ $t('reset.email_sent') }}</span>
</q-banner>
<br>
<div>
<strong>{{ $t('reset.check_email') }}</strong>
</div>
</div>
</div>
</div>
</template>
<script lang="ts" src="./requestresetpwd.ts">
</script>
<style lang="scss" scoped>
@import './requestresetpwd';
</style>